The document summarizes a study on the operational efficiency of financial inclusion in Puducherry, India. It discusses the methodology used, which involved collecting primary data through interviews with 500 no-frill bank account holders selected across 7 banks and 125 branches in Puducherry. Chi-square tests found significant relationships between household bank accounts and factors like gender, age, marital status, education, and occupation. The study concludes that banks need to reduce loan requirements, increase financial awareness programs, and leverage technology to better serve rural customers and promote inclusion.
